Understanding Gaming Influencer Marketing

What is Gaming Influencer Marketing?

Gaming influencer marketing represents a strategic approach that leverages the reach and credibility of influential figures within the gaming community to promote products, services, or brands. These influencers often have dedicated fan bases across platforms such as Twitch, YouTube, and TikTok, making them ideal for marketers looking to connect with specific audiences in an authentic way. By working with these individuals, brands can generate buzz, enhance engagement, and ultimately drive sales.

In essence, gaming influencer marketing revolves around the partnership between brands and influencers to create content that resonates with the gaming community, whether through sponsored streams, product placements, or collaborative content creation.

The Role of Influencers in the Gaming Community

Influencers in the gaming space often serve multiple roles—from entertainers and reviewers to educators and community builders. They live-stream games, share gameplay tips, host gaming events, and foster discussions around game mechanics, storylines, and industry trends. Their ability to convey authentic experiences turns casual viewers into loyal followers, leading to high conversion rates for the brands they promote.

This influence stems from their credibility and relatability; audiences trust the opinions of these individuals more than traditional advertisements, viewing them as peers rather than marketers. Influencers can showcase products in a real-world context, demonstrating their use while interacting with their audience in real-time, which boosts engagement rates and strengthens community ties.

Crafting Your Gaming Influencer Marketing Strategy

Identifying Your Target Audience

Understanding your target audience is foundational to a successful gaming influencer marketing strategy. Start by defining demographic factors such as age, gender, gaming preferences, and geographical location. Analyze existing customer data to identify trends and tailor your messaging accordingly.

Consider conducting surveys or focus groups with gamers to gather insights about their interests. Additionally, explore which social platforms they frequent the most, as this will impact your choice of influencers and campaign strategies.

Selecting the Right Influencers

The next step is selecting the right influencers who align with your brand values and target audience. Consider factors such as follower count, engagement rates, niche relevance, and content style. Look for influencers who genuinely connect with their audience and share values similar to your brand.

Utilize influencer marketing platforms to streamline your selection process, providing analytics on engagement and audience demographics, ensuring that your partnerships yield the best results.

Setting Campaign Goals and Metrics

Before launching your campaign, it’s crucial to set clear goals. Whether you’re aiming to increase brand awareness, boost sales, or drive traffic to your website, your objectives will guide your strategy.

Establish key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ure success, such as:

  • Engagement rates (likes, shares, comments)
  • Conversion rates (click-throughs, purchases)
  • New audience growth (follower counts)
  • Overall return on investment (ROI)

Regularly monitor these metrics to gauge performance and adjust your strategy as needed.

Executing a Successful Campaign

Creating Engaging Content with Influencers

The heart of an influencer marketing campaign is content creation. Collaborate with your chosen influencers to develop engaging, authentic content that tells a story about your brand or product. This could include live streams, gameplay videos, tutorials, or unboxings. Ensure the content aligns with both the influencer’s style and your branding guidelines.

Encourage influencers to use their creativity while integrating key messages about your product, rather than following a strict script, which helps maintain authenticity.

Leveraging Social Media Platforms for Maximized Reach

Social media platforms are pivotal for gaming influencer marketing. With a plethora of channels available—such as Twitch, YouTube, Instagram, and TikTok—each has its unique user base and content format. Tailor your approach to suit the platform’s strengths; for example, TikTok thrives on short, entertaining snippets, while YouTube is more suited for in-depth reviews.

Also, utilize features such as hashtags, stories, and live gaming sessions to enhance engagement and widen your reach. Collaborating on a multi-platform campaign can attract diverse audiences and strengthen your message.

Measuring Campaign Success and ROI

Once your campaign is live, measuring its success is vital to understanding the impact of your influencer partnerships. Use analytics tools to track KPIs designated during your planning phase.

Evaluate the total reach, engagement levels, conversions, and overall ROI post-campaign. This analysis will not only assess the immediate success of the campaign but will also provide valuable insights for future projects, enabling continuous improvement and strategy refinement.

Challenges in Gaming Influencer Marketing

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

Like any marketing strategy, influencer marketing comes with its challenges. Common pitfalls include:

  • Choosing the Wrong Influencer: Picking influencers solely based on follower count rather than engagement and alignment with your brand’s values can lead to poor performance.
  • Neglecting FTC Guidelines: Ensure all partnerships are disclosed to comply with legal regulations, as failure to do so can result in penalties.
  • Overlooking Engagement Quality: Focus on influencers who cultivate genuine interaction with their audience rather than just high numbers.

Managing Influencer Relationships

Building and maintaining a positive relationship with influencers is crucial for long-term partnership success. Clear communication regarding expectations, compensation, and campaign goals is vital. Regular check-ins and constructive feedback loops can help to foster cooperation and mutual growth.

Consider engaging influencers beyond campaigns by involving them in product development discussions or inviting them to exclusive events. This builds brand loyalty and can lead to more authentic promotions in the future.
